The global medical subcutaneous insulin infusion pump market is set for steady expansion through 2033, supported by rising diabetes prevalence, better reimbursement for advanced insulin delivery, and wider use of connected diabetes care platforms. The market is projected to reach about USD 7.8 billion by 2033, advancing at a CAGR of 9.2% from the 2026 base year, as pumps move from a specialist therapy option into a broader chronic care management tool. Demand is being shaped by the shift toward tighter glycemic control, the need to reduce hypoglycemic events, and the growing preference for automated and wearable delivery systems that improve adherence. The market also benefits from stronger patient education, stronger clinician acceptance of data-driven therapy, and steady device upgrades that make pump use simpler and less invasive.
From 2019 to 2025, the market moved from a relatively concentrated niche into a broader adoption phase, although growth was uneven during the pandemic years when elective care and diabetes clinic visits were disrupted. Global revenue is estimated to have risen from around USD 2.3 billion in 2019 to about USD 4.1 billion in 2025, reflecting a mid to high single digit historical growth path and a meaningful recovery in device starts after 2021. The 2026 base year is estimated at approximately USD 4.5 billion, with forecast growth accelerating as closed loop systems, patch pumps, and digital monitoring become more common in both mature and emerging markets. By 2033, the market’s value is expected to nearly double from the base year, driven by recurring consumables, broader coverage of type 1 and insulin dependent type 2 patients, and deeper penetration in outpatient care pathways.

By type, the market is divided mainly into tethered pumps, patch pumps, and hybrid closed loop systems, with hybrid systems expanding fastest because they combine infusion, sensing, and algorithm-driven control in one workflow. Tethered systems still hold a large installed base because of familiarity and wide clinician acceptance, but patch pumps are taking share among patients who value discreteness and simpler wearability. By application, type 1 diabetes remains the core use case, while insulin dependent type 2 diabetes is becoming a larger growth engine as physicians increasingly target tighter control for high-risk adults. Regionally, North America leads in value, Europe follows with strong reimbursement support, and Asia Pacific is the fastest expanding region by unit growth, while Latin America, the Middle East, and Africa remain more price sensitive but offer meaningful long-term upside.
Several drivers are supporting the market’s next phase of growth, starting with the rising global diabetes burden and the clinical need for more precise insulin delivery. Pumps help reduce glycemic variability, cut the time spent in hypoglycemia, and support better adherence than multiple daily injections for many patients, which makes them attractive to both clinicians and payers. Wider digital health integration is also important because connected pumps generate therapy data that can be used for remote care and outcome tracking, making therapy management more efficient. In multiple markets, Stats N Data sees the strongest demand where reimbursement, patient education, and endocrinology access improve at the same time, because those three factors shorten the gap between product availability and actual usage.
The main restraints are cost, training burden, and uneven reimbursement, especially in lower and middle income countries where out of pocket payment still dominates. Pump therapy can remain expensive once device cost, consumables, sensors, and follow up are included, which limits adoption among price sensitive patients even when clinical need is high. Some users also struggle with wear fatigue, alarm burden, or concerns about device visibility, and those issues can slow retention after first use. In addition, supply chain disruptions, import duties, and uneven service networks can weaken uptake in smaller markets, making it harder for vendors to scale beyond urban hospitals and specialist centers.
Opportunities are expanding around premium connected care, pediatric diabetes management, and insulin dependent type 2 cohorts that have historically been under served by pump manufacturers. Vendors can win share by bundling devices with coaching, cloud based monitoring, and service plans that simplify adoption for patients and providers alike. There is also room for lower cost pump variants tailored to emerging markets, especially where financing models or insurer partnerships can reduce first year adoption barriers. Stats N Data expects the strongest upside to come from companies that design not just devices, but complete therapy pathways that support initiation, training, and ongoing adherence.
The biggest challenges are regulatory complexity, product differentiation, and the need to prove value in real world use rather than only in controlled trials. As more systems converge on similar automated dosing features, vendors will need stronger evidence on reliability, user experience, and long term outcomes to justify premium pricing. Cybersecurity, data privacy, and interoperability are also rising concerns as pump ecosystems become more connected to mobile apps and clinician dashboards. For manufacturers, the commercial test is no longer only whether a device works, but whether it fits into a care model that providers can support at scale without adding operational friction.
Technology trends are moving toward smaller form factors, smarter algorithms, longer wear times, and easier integration with continuous glucose monitoring systems. Hybrid closed loop platforms are now setting the standard for premium offerings, while patch pump designs are improving patient convenience and broadening appeal in urban consumer segments. Battery life, remote software updates, and app based therapy management are becoming important purchase criteria, particularly in markets with high smartphone penetration. Artificial intelligence is also beginning to influence dosage optimization, and cloud connected data platforms are helping providers manage larger patient groups with less manual review.
Regionally, North America continues to lead in revenue because of stronger reimbursement and earlier uptake of high feature devices, while Europe is characterized by steadier adoption and more system wide purchasing discipline. Asia Pacific is the fastest growing region on a volume basis, driven by China, India, Japan, and South Korea, each of which is at a different stage of affordability and clinical readiness. Latin America and the Middle East are progressing steadily, but growth is uneven and often tied to private insurance depth or national procurement cycles. Africa remains the least penetrated region, yet urban private care centers in South Africa and select Gulf linked treatment pathways are creating a small but important premium market.
Competition is centered on product performance, service support, ecosystem integration, and reimbursement execution rather than on price alone. Leading vendors are investing in connected platforms, sensor compatibility, and clinician training to defend installed bases and reduce switching. Newer entrants are challenging incumbents with simpler patch based systems and lower friction user interfaces, which is forcing the market to balance innovation with reliability and safety. In practice, the most successful companies are pairing hardware with consumables, digital support, and payer engagement, because recurring revenue and patient retention now matter as much as initial device placements.
